web-dev-qa-db-fra.com

Localisation: thème Domaine du texte de l'enfant

Je crée une série de WP thèmes enfants qui dépendent d'un thème parent que je vais utiliser comme cadre.

J'ai besoin que ces thèmes (parents et enfants) soient localisés.

from http://codex.wordpress.org/Function_Reference/load_theme_textdomain J'ai compris qu'il me fallait ajouter les éléments suivants à mon thème:

add_action('after_setup_theme', 'my_theme_setup');
function my_theme_setup(){
    load_theme_textdomain('mytextdomain', get_template_directory() . '/lang');
}

cela va dans le functions.php, je suppose

cependant, qu'en est-il des thèmes pour enfants? functions.php d'un thème pour enfants remplace functions.php d'un thème parent

textdomain ("mytextdomain") du thème enfant doit-il être identique au thème parent ou différent (et appeler la fonction load_theme_textdomain avec un nom de fonction différent (voir le code "my_theme_Setup ()" ci-dessus)?

quelle est la bonne façon de localiser un thème parent et un thème enfant?

merci d'avoir clarifié cela :)

1
unfulvio

Les thèmes pour enfants doivent utiliser load_child_theme_textdomain(). Vous pouvez le trouver dans /wp-includes/l10n.php. Utilisez un nouveau slug et un fichier po séparé.

3
fuxia